I guess it depends on where you are staying. There's a Walgreens & another drug store both of which sell soda in the heart / sqaure of OSJ.

I don't know about a town car but the taxi's are clean & regulated. You get a receipt & it states your fare.

What's your 1st port of call? If it's St. Thomas, there's a grocery store just up the block from the pier & a K-Mart a bit farther -- you can see it from deck. [img]http://messages.cruisecritic.com/infopop/emoticons/icon_smile.gif[/img] I brought 2 cans of Pepsi to get me to St. Thomas & then restocked there. It was much easier.
